Output 7028fe37188a0672b92c6ccf1772baef7b15139fb9923a2684505ad2aa594fa9:0

value
31252895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0aa64a58b81b7e724c12f493b5a2a9af3ccbe10 OP_EQUAL
address
3KFjnVtVGgi3ufKvW9BJpGDCv8zEg767D5
transaction
7028fe37188a0672b92c6ccf1772baef7b15139fb9923a2684505ad2aa594fa9
spent
true